Step into the luminous mind of a medieval giant through the sharp wit and deep reverence of one of the 20th century’s greatest writers.In this remarkable portrait, G.K. Chesterton-master of paradox and champion of common sense-brings St. Thomas Aquinas to life not as a distant philosopher, but as a vibrant, practical thinker whose ideas helped shape Western civilization. Far from dry theology, this is philosophy with fire: a defense of reason, of truth, and of a deeply human faith.Chesterton’s brilliance lies not just in explaining Aquinas, but in making him relatable, urgent, and alive. With humor, clarity, and contagious enthusiasm, he paints a picture of a man whose thought bridged heaven and earth-and still speaks powerfully to the modern soul.Whether you’re a believer, a skeptic, or simply a lover of great minds, this book is a revelatory journey into one of history’s most astonishing intellects, guided by a writer who understood him better than most.
